Barrow-Upon-Humber has less crime — 10 vs 144 incidents in February 2026.
Cottingham recorded substantially more crime than Barrow-Upon-Humber in February 2026 — 144 incidents compared to 10, a 14.4x difference. The crime profiles diverge meaningfully: Barrow-Upon-Humber sees higher rates of Other crime (2) and Drugs (1), while Cottingham has more Shoplifting (18) and Public order (16).
